BRIGADE x ESTRADA “VESSEL”

In the spring of 2020, Aaron Maldonado, reached out to Angel to discuss a potential second collaboration before he headed to New Mexico. “We wanted it to be something simple and beautiful and decided a tumbler would be that” said Angel. “The ceramic vessel was meant to symbolize humans and all that we go through in life. Similar to the clay and its process. After being stretched, drowned, and burned the ceramic is still beautiful and useful.”

 
 
 

Place Keeping: Middle Main Poughkeepsie

In 2020, Angel received a grant from Hudson River Housing and Arts Mid-Hudson to fund the creation of this video. The idea of the project was to help address gentrification and displacement in Middle Main Poughkeepsie by allowing the community to be seen and heard. Along with this video, Angel had a series of shows and craft sales with pieces available for “pay what you want” to allow his work to be accessible.

“This project meant so much to me because it was my last project before moving to New Mexico. The juxtaposition between highlighting the community I grew up in and the idea of a community member spreading their wings to grow felt very important.”

 
 

Brigade U.S.A x Estrada Design 2017

A meeting of the minds between Angel and Aaron Maldonado to create a limited-edition capsule for Brigade in 2017. This 4 piece collection included a wheel-thrown ashtray, work pants, t-shirt, and hoodie.

“This collaboration brings me fond memories of commuting to the city to link with Aaron and just creating and hanging out. Learning so much about the industry and our ability to design and produce products. The event we held in our hometown was nothing short of legendary.”
